What are the different types of pizza peels?

These are the most common types of pizza peel: 1 Square wooden peel for launching pizza 2 Square metal peel with perforations for launching pizza 3 Round solid metal peel for turning pizza 4 Round perforated metal peel for turning pizza.

How thick should a pizza peel be?

How thick should a pizza peel be? Metal pizza peels are typically 1 to 3 millimeters—or about 3/64 to 1/8 inches—thick. Wood peels are thicker, usually between 1/2 and 3/4 inches.

How many pizza peels do you need?

Wooden peels are the optimal choice for transferring raw, topped pizza dough into the oven. This is because it sticks less than it would to a metal peel. It is not great for removing the cooked pizza as it is too thick, hence why we recommend purchasing 2 peels.

What is the advantage of a perforated pizza peel?

The main benefits of a perforated peel are that it gets rid of excess flour, lets the pizza slide off the peel easily, and is the lightest option. In addition to that, it also causes less condensation and sticking.

What is the shape?Is it spherical or rectangular?The rectangular peel is a safe and classic choice since it has a greater surface area in touch with the pizza and the grip point, which is used to lift the pizza, is only milled at the front.It is also easier to use than the round peel.The circular peel features an extended grip point with a soft, regular milling across a significant extension of the curve, allowing the pizza-maker to pick up the pizza even from the side, rather than just from the front, as seen in the illustration.Furthermore, because the pizzas are closer to the inside of the oven due to the bevelled edges, they are more easily handled and the oven’s efficiency is increased.

2.The size of the object Pizza peel heads are available in a variety of sizes, which must be chosen in accordance with the size of the pizza you want to make.In general, the diameter of a regular pizza is between 33 and 36 cm.Maxi pizzas may be as large as 45-50 cm in diameter.When pizzas become larger, we might refer to them as ″Rome Style Pizza″ or ″Pizza by the meter.″ Large rectangular pizza peels are required for the preparation of this style of pizza.The handle size, on the other hand, should be determined by the depth of the oven that you want to use.

  1. Ensure that the handle is long enough to prevent burning.
  2. Handles shorter than 30 cm are recommended for tunnel ovens and tiny ovens, which are typically seen in pubs and restaurants.
  3. Professional electrical ovens require handles with a length of 60 cm, whilst large artisanal ovens require handles with lengths ranging from 120 to 200 cm.

Pizza peels are available in a variety of various materials.The following are the benefits and drawbacks of the most often used building materials: Pizza peels made of wood.Wood is a classic building material, but it has a short lifespan and is difficult to maintain.Pizza peels made of stainless steel.Pizza peels made of steel, as opposed to those made of wood, last longer, are smoother, and are stronger: they are more resistant to the impacts that may occur when moving between the working surface and the oven, and they are easier to clean.They are, on the other hand, significantly heavier than aluminum-based products.

  • Pizza peels made of aluminum.
  • They are lightweight and can help to lessen the amount of fiction that exists between the dough and the peel head, allowing for more fluid and natural movements while lifting up pizzas and putting them into the oven.
  • Because of the way these peels are constructed, they are both sturdy and durable.
  • The perforated surface of the heads helps to further reduce the weight of the heads.
  • They are, on the other hand, more delicate in nature than the other varieties of peels.

Pizza Peel Carrying Surface

  1. Solid carry surfaces and perforated carry surfaces are the two most common types of carry surfaces for pizza peels.
  2. It is this solid carrying surface that is found in the majority of pizza peels; it is a flat, complete surface that does not have any dents, holes, or other ridges.
  3. A perforated carrying surface, on the other hand, is a surface that has a large number of microscopic holes throughout it.
  4. The advantage of using a perforated peel is that the holes in the peel will aid in the removal of extra flour from the dough.

You want to get rid of this flour because it will burn in a hot oven, causing smoke and bad flavors to permeate the pizza dough and toppings.Metal is the most widely used material for perforated peels.However, because of the additional holes, pizza doughs cling to the peel less than they would to a metal peel with a solid carrying surface.

Pizza Peel Thickness

  1. What thickness do you want your pizza peel to be?
  2. In general, a thin pizza peel works better for this purpose.
  3. The reason for this is that thin pizza is both simpler to move from your working surface to the peel and easier to reach beneath the pizza while you’re pulling it out of the oven, therefore thin pizza is recommended.
  4. The thinness of most metal peels (with a carrying surface formed of metal) is due to the fact that the material allows for thinner peels.

Nonetheless, you don’t want the peel to be too thin, since this would result in the carrying surface being frail.As a rule of thumb, you’re looking for something between 3 and 4 mm (3/64-1/8 inch).Because wood cannot be made as thin as metal, wooden peels are often thicker than metal peels.A wooden peel is excellent for placing the pizza into the oven, but it is less effective for removing it from the oven.Wooden peels are often too thick to allow for easy sliding under the pizza (without using any tools to lift the pizza).Using a thin, beveled edge can be helpful, but in general, using metal peels to remove the pizza from the oven is recommended.

Pizza Peel Material

Wooden Pizza Peels

  1. Pizza peels made of wood are a classic cooking equipment that have been in use for hundreds, if not thousands of years.
  2. The advantage of using a wooden peel is that the pizza does not adhere to it as much as it does to other types of peel.
  3. The reason for this is because the rougher, more uneven surface allows for greater airflow beneath the pizza.
  4. In this case, it is an excellent tool for moving the pizza from the tabletop or baking surface to the oven.

Another advantage of using hardwood peeling is the lower cost.They are rather inexpensive to purchase.The disadvantage of wooden peels is that they are difficult to clean and require more upkeep than other types of peels.Heat and water must also be used with caution in order to avoid cracking and warping of the wooden surfaces.Wooden peels are also often thick, which makes it more difficult to get beneath the pizza to turn it or remove it from the oven when it is done.

Metal Pizza Peels

  1. Most metal pizza peels are made of stainless steel or aluminum, depending on the model.
  2. They are more durable and simpler to clean than hardwood peels, and they require less maintenance in general.
  3. Metal peels are also thinner than wooden peels, which makes them the ideal tool for getting under the dough while working with it.
  4. The use of metal peels to flip the pizza in the oven and remove the pizza from the oven when it’s done is consequently recommended.

The most significant disadvantage of using metal peels is that uncooked dough adheres more readily to the peel.You may acquire a perforated aluminum peel to help you overcome this disadvantage.Because of the numerous little pores on the transporting surface, dough adheres to these peels significantly less effectively.These perforations enable air to circulate beneath the dough.Consequently, there is no possibility of a vacuum being produced between the dough and the peel, which is the primary reason dough sticks to a metal surface.You may learn more about perforated pizza peels and their advantages by reading this article on the subject.

How to Use a Pizza Peel 

The primary function of a pizza peel is to transport the pizza from one location to another. There are several different types of peels required for the various phases of the pizza baking process.

Transfer the Pizza in to the Oven

  1. This is one of my favorite things to do with a wooden peel.
  2. As previously stated, pizza does not adhere as readily to wooden peels as it does to metal peels, making the wooden peel the ideal peel for this application.
  3. When it comes to assembling the pizza, you have two options: either on the tabletop or on the peel.
  4. I like to form the pizza and top it on the countertop in order to reduce the amount of time spent on the paddle.

The rationale for this is that it will reduce the likelihood of it being trapped.If you’re concerned about the form of the pizza as you pull it over to the peel, you can always modify it before it goes into the oven to make it more appealing.Before transferring the pizza on the peel, gently sprinkle the peel with semolina to prevent sticking.The Semolina flour really helps the dough slide off the counter and adds a little bit of texture to the finished product.If you want to be sure your pizza doesn’t get stuck, I recommend shaking it on the paddle immediately before you put it in the oven.If the dough has been stuck to the work surface, gently scrape it with a dough scraper or a spatula to free it before transferring it to the baking sheet.

If you want to use a metal pizza peel instead of a wooden one, I propose that you proceed in the same manner as you would with a wooden peel, except that you sprinkle the dough a little more before transferring it to the peel.You may also require additional semolina to ensure that the mixture does not stick.

Turning the Pizza in The Oven

  1. A wood-fired oven or your home oven will not transfer heat uniformly, regardless of what you’re cooking in it.
  2. Using a thin metal peel is the best option if you need to move the pizza around in the oven to guarantee equal baking.
  3. There are special peels designed specifically for this function, but for the home chef, a conventional metal peel should suffice just fine.
  4. If you bake pizza in a wood-fired oven, it is important to return the pizza to the same area after it has been trun.

Otherwise, the hot deck of the oven may burn the pizza throughout the baking process.However, the heated surface may cause the bottom of the pizza to bake more quickly than the top.You may use the pizza peel to move the pizza closer to the dome of the oven, where the air is hotter, for a few seconds to finish it off if the crust is done but the cheese has not melted yet.

Remove the Pizza From the Oven

Using a thin metal peel, similar to the one used for rotating pizza in the oven, it is simple to remove the pizza from the oven. You may also use a wooden pizza peel for this, but a metal pizza peel is preferable since it is simpler to slip beneath the pizza when using a metal pizza peel. When the pizza has finished baking, you won’t have to worry about it adhering to the pan.

Pizza Peel Maintenance

Wooden Pizza Peel Maintenance

  • I would avoid cutting pizza on the wooden peel since it would leave scratches on the surface of the pizza.
  • In order to prevent the wood from warping or cracking while you’re cleaning, avoid using too much water, especially hot water, throughout the cleaning process.
  • In order to avoid this, you should never wash it in the dishwasher!
  • Before washing, I recommend scraping the peel with a plastic dough scraper to remove any debris that has become adhered to it.
  • Alternatively, a metal scraper may be used, but if you’re not cautious, it’s possible to damage the surface of the wood.
  • A nylon brush or moist towel can then be used to clean the surface.

Before keeping it in a dry location, make sure to wipe out any extra water from it.

Mineral Oil for Wooden Pizza Peels

  • Mineral oil should be applied to a wooden pizza peel to ensure that it lasts longer.
  • Although it is not absolutely essential, putting oil to your peel is a good idea if you have a great, excellent peel that you want to keep for a long time.
  • The advantage of adding mineral oil is that it keeps the wood moist, which prevents it from warping and breaking over time.
  • Pour 1-2 teaspoons of mineral oil onto the peel and spread with a piece of cloth to seal in the moisture.
  • Regular reapplication of oil (every 3 months or so) is recommended.
  • When selecting a mineral oil, be certain that it is suitable for consumption.

Metal Pizza Peel Maintenance

When it comes to metal pizza peels, there isn’t much to be concerned about. Because the majority of metal peels are made of stainless steel or aluminum, you may clean them with soap and hot water if necessary. Because of the flat surface, it is frequently simpler to wipe away any residue that has become adhered to metal peeling and other metal surfaces.
